Mechanism of action

Buserelin-NHNH2 sits within the Endocrine research class (CPC reference LHRH-015). Endocrine peptides bind class A/B GPCRs and RTKs on hormone-responsive tissues, triggering canonical cAMP, IP₃/Ca²⁺, and MAPK pathways that regulate secretion, growth, and metabolism. Investigators typically incorporate Buserelin-NHNH2 as a reference standard, tool ligand, or substrate in the assay contexts listed above. HTRF cAMP, calcium mobilization (FLIPR), and radioligand binding are the standard readouts.

What quality specifications apply to Buserelin-NHNH2?

Research-grade peptides in the CPC catalog are synthesized by solid-phase peptide synthesis (SPPS), purified by preparative RP-HPLC, and characterized by analytical HPLC and mass spectrometry. Typical purity is ≥95%; certificate of analysis is available on request.
